Stephanie Vaquer Retains NXT Women’s Championship in Thrilling Fatal 4-Way Match
In a stunning display of skill and determination, Chilean wrestler Stephanie Vaquer successfully defended her NXT Women’s Championship against Giulia, Jordynne Grace, and Jaida Parker in a Fatal 4-Way Match at NXT Stand & Deliver 2025 on Saturday, April 19. With this victory, Vaquer reaches a remarkable 38 days as NXT Women’s Champion, solidifying her reign and reaffirming her position among the elite in the NXT brand.
